Earlier this week,North Dakota State Attorney General Drew Wrigley wrote a letter to Red River Trust, stating that its corporations and LLCs were prohibited from owning or leasing farmland or ranchland in the state of North Dakota. Wrigley added that these entities were banned from engaging in farming or ranching.. Gates also owns land in Arizona (25,750 acres), Illinois (17,940),Mississippi (16,963),Washington (16,097), Florida (14,828), Idaho (9,233), Indiana (9,136), Ohio (8,915), California (4,509), Colorado (2,270), Michigan (2,167), Wisconsin (1,188), Wyoming (975), North Carolina (874), Iowa (552), and New Mexico (1).
